Governance Reporting Associate

Were seeking someone to join our Budapest Business Management team as a skilled Governance Reporting Associate in Centralized Management to manage reporting solutions that support the Finance Management Committees data-driven decisions. You will collaborate with stakeholders to develop dashboards and reports for efficient analytics. What youll do in the role:

  • Manage the monthly distribution of standardized reports to Finance Management Committee clients with included analysis of identified trends where applicable

  • Deliver enhanced analytics on client inquiries to facilitate informed strategic decision-making

  • Collaborate with Business Intelligence (BI) developers on automation and dashboard development initiatives including the preparation of Business Requirements Documents conducting testing procedures and overseeing project progress through to completion

  • Collaborate with a varied group of colleagues in Finance and across the Firm

  • Responsible for and lead aspects of individual and team deliverables and projects leveraging in-depth knowledge of Finance functional area product and/or client segments

  • Adhere to the Firms risk and regulatory standards policies and controls; proactively identify ways to reduce risk in work

  • Act as a culture carrier; embody and set an example of the Firms values and hold yourself and others accountable to Firm standards


What youll bring to the role:

  • Strong problem-solving skills and ability to work with complex datasets

  • Excellent communication skills in both verbal and written English; ability to develop quick rapport at all levels with both technical and business stakeholders

  • Strong numerical and analytical skills with great attention to detail

  • Flexibility to adapt to changing environments quickly and effectively

  • In-depth knowledge of Finance functional area product and/or client segment and technical skills as well as of industry and competitive environment

  • Ability to operate independently with respect to most job responsibilities

  • Ability to provide positive and constructive feedback and innovate processes

  • At least 4 years relevant experience would generally be expected to find the skills required for this role
